YNW Melly’s new trial date for his double murder case is set for September 10, 2025, with a pretrial meeting for the witness tampering case scheduled on December 5.

The 25-year-old rapper, real name Jamell Demons, is accused of murdering two childhood friends, Chris “YNW Juvy” Thomas and Anthony “YNW Sakchaser” Williams, in 2018, making it look like a drive-by shooting. The trial is set to begin on the specified date, but Melly’s side seems less certain.

Melly’s attorney, Raven Liberty, mentioned, “At this juncture, it is merely a date. We await a ruling from the Fourth DCA on the suppression motions keeping out the text messages. Once the ruling comes back, Mr. Demons can demand a speedy trial.” Melly’s mother also commented, “We are gonna trust God on everything like we’ve been doing. We’re gonna see where it goes. It’s all we can do.”

YNW Melly’s retrial will have been delayed by almost a year by the time it gets underway after the rapper was hit with the witness tampering charge, stemming from allegations he conspired to stop a witness from testifying in court. The Florida native has been held in jail since his arrest in 2019 and will have spent over six years behind bars by the time the case reaches court again.

A mistrial was declared in the initial trial after the jury could not come to a unanimous verdict regarding the rapper, who has denied the double homicide. His attorneys recently moved to try and exclude phone calls between his fellow defendant YNW Bortlen and his girlfriend Juneviah Molina from being used as evidence in the trial.
